Henry Baxter Drive Property Prices vs Surrounding Areas
Keresley End
Bag a bargain in Keresley End, where house prices average 31% lower than on Henry Baxter Drive. (£238,500 vs £345,300) As indicated, settling in Keresley End could mean keeping hold of an extra £106,800.
CV7 8
The CV7 8 sector's average price tag is a breezy 29% lighter than Henry Baxter Drive's. (£245,000 vs £345,300) When the dust settles, a Henry Baxter Drive purchase could add around £100,300 to your costs.
i.e. CV7
Henry Baxter Drive's average property price is 18% higher than the CV7 district's average. (£345,300 vs £282,200). So in the grand story of buying a home, choosing Henry Baxter Drive could add a chapter costing an additional £63,100 compared to CV7.
i.e. Coventry
Coventry gives you house; Henry Baxter Drive gives you hype - for 39% more. (£345,300 vs £211,000). So unless you're sold on the name, Coventry might give you more for £134,600 less.
